Sorry, can't find the original poster's address but a very simple natural shampoo can be made with dried Soapwort (Saponaria)
You need approximately:
1 oz of dried soapwort
1 to 1 ½ pts of water (pure/spring/distilled)
1 oz herbs of choice (based on what type of shampoo-see - note below)

Put boiling water on the dried soapwort and soak overnight. Bring mixture to boil (in an enamel pan) and simmer, covered for about 15-20 minutes. Stir in herbs, and store it, covered, until it is cool enough to use. Strain before using.

Note: choose one or combination of herbs for properties desired.

Examples:

Marsh mallow is used for dry hair
Peppermint/Lavender used for oily hair
Marigold/Calendula for red hair
